LeBron James made history again this Wednesday by recording a big triple-double in the game against the Kings. Unfortunately Anthony Davis was not at his level, and after the defeat, No. 23 spoke about the state of health of his partner.

In a perfect world, LeBron James could afford to play 25 minutes every night to help his young teammates in the quest for a new title for the Lakers… But at almost 39 years old, the King is still obliged to shoot on the rope so that his team has the slightest chance of existing in the Western Conference.

This Wednesday for example, against the Kings, he spent more than 35 minutes on the floor and had to surpass himself to compensate for the shortcomings of Anthony Davis who was hampered by his hip. In defeat, LeBron was once again historic with his 28 points, 12 assists and 10 rebounds, and he improved in certain all-time categories.

LeBron talks about Anthony Davis and his injury

On his own floor, LeBron James became the 8th best 3-point shooter in history, the 5th best in terms of triple-doubles, and he is above all the second oldest player to record such statistical prowess, just behind Karl Malone. But all this is very futile in defeat, and afterwards, he spoke about the failings of his team and the short night of his partner.

We lost the ball too many times, the Kings did a good job getting on the passing lines. Sometimes it killed our positive dynamic in attack and canceled out our good defenses. Regarding AD, I agree with what he says, I don’t want to guess what he felt or not. If he says his hip wasn’t an excuse it’s the truth. The Kings arrived fresh, and we played our 3rd game in 4 nights.

Anthony Davis didn’t want to use his hip pain to justify his 9-point, 9-rebound outing, so LeBron James went his way. He explained that the Lakers’ biggest flaw had been turnovers, and even with an interior in top shape, this problem would not necessarily have been resolved. Quick rest for them.

At 38 years old, LeBron James still has to draw on all his resources, which should not necessarily be easy. He also has to deal with a slightly injured Anthony Davis who is not always consistent. We understand his fatigue.
